Output 26c45e8be873ce21b28f11d733c62fa0ef433ed33200ef93fe36c4f184ccbf6d:4

value
1585000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af345788296d1c1816cf5fdb6743f605b58f30c4 OP_EQUAL
address
3HfQstqU1SxVfeSTuo22whMb4nxRMThvU3
transaction
26c45e8be873ce21b28f11d733c62fa0ef433ed33200ef93fe36c4f184ccbf6d